Broader Economic and Social Implications
The extensive effects of digital pathology surpass the interior of clinical labs.
In economic terms, the migration from established to digital pathology is overhauling healthcare investment and budget allocation.
Through the reduction of the time taken for slide examination and reducing diagnostic mistakes, digital pathology produces appreciable cost reductions within healthcare networks. The financial savings in turn can be used in the advancement of scientific studies and patient care, generating a beneficial cycle that drives more innovation and better patient results.

Societally, the inclusion of digital pathology offers the possibility to make accessible to all access to premium pathology diagnostic medical services.
Under-served plus neglected zones, that access within skilled tissue have a peek here experts might be insufficient, will benefit significantly from telepathology. Tech-based photo outputs can be sent across vast wide geographical spans, allowing geographically remote teleconsultations along with guaranteeing that those in need are provided with skilled insights independent of the individual’s physical locale. The universal access to expertise is critically significant at a time seeing that medical service disparities are widespread a major challenge.
Additionally, the information produced through the application of electronic pathological examination makes available copious possibilities for statistical analysis plus population health campaigns. Extensive data compilations reflecting minute alterations concerning sample form affords insights concerning disease dynamics, the effectiveness of treatments, together with in addition contextual factors impacting health outcomes.
